DMA Reunites with Benson

Regan Benson’s bi-weekly speaking campaign against the Englewood, Colorado, City Council saw the unexpected return of Christopher “Denver Metro Audits” Cordova Monday night as the convicted felon joined Benson to record the city council meeting.

Cordova and Benson’s friendship had allegedly been severed last year after Benson’s actions in organizing several raids using large amounts of auditors on the Sheridan, Colorado, City Hall had resulted in multiple arrests of Cordova and then girlfriend Teresa “Sweet T” Neal.

Before the arrests and the apparent end of their friendship, Cordova, Neal and Benson had been inseparable, carrying out multiple protests and demonstrations withing Englewood and Sheridan last year and providing a formidable trio that would essentially “tag team” police or public officials who they confronted.

Cordova was essentially a background player during Monday night’s events, holding his multi-purpose camera stand and quietly engaging with Benson. He did not actively live stream the event and seemed to be there more in support of Benson’s efforts than for personal profit.

The meeting itself featured the debut of Benson associate “MJ,” a formerly homeless woman who is currently doing her community service for a dumpster diving arrest through Benson’s non-profit. MJ delivered a speech during the community feedback portion of the City Council meeting, lavishing praise on Benson for all her efforts helping the homeless in the area.

Benson, who had previously spoke out against any cheering or reaction during the city council meetings, encouraged the assembled crowd to clap and cheer for MJ after MJ finished her speech. Benson then went into her standard attacks on the Englewood City Council for their policies that she claims will “outlaw” homelessness.

After the event, Benson promised that she would continue to fight for “economic responsibility” by the Englewood City Council and that major changes would be coming.
